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
223 44665663 476521
413 902 071
413 902 071
04 779 94 64259890 76318618
All about undefined
Interested in learning more?
413 902 071
04 779 94 64259890 76318618
See more
63145895 11090 5852732567
955 6644 4853919
See more
8039513 174645 310
00933107 441 5804028
See more